ResMed Inc. vs Vistra Corp — how do they compare? ResMed Inc. trades at $196 (market cap $28.81B), while Vistra Corp trades at $162.3 (market cap $53.27B). The key difference: Vistra Corp is the larger of the two by market cap, and ResMed Inc. pays the higher dividend (1.21%). Which is the better fit depends on your goals.

About ResMed Inc.

ResMed is one of the largest respiratory care device companies globally, primarily developing and supplying flow generators, masks and accessories for the treatment of sleep apnea. Increasing diagnosis of sleep apnea combined with ageing populations and increasing prevalence of obesity is resulting in a structurally growing market. The company earns roughly two thirds of its revenue in the Americas and the balance across other regions dominated by Europe, Japan and Australia. Recent developments and acquisitions have focused on digital health as ResMed is aiming to differentiate itself through the provision of clinical data for use by the patient, medical care advisor and payer in the out-of-hospital setting.

About Vistra Corp

Vistra is a leading integrated retail electricity and power generation company that serves as a critical infrastructure provider for the digital economy. It operates a diversified portfolio of zero-carbon nuclear and renewable assets alongside a massive, flexible natural gas fleet, positioning it as an indispensable partner for energy-intensive AI data centers and industrial electrification.
